For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public schools serving 366 students in 82082, WY.
The top-ranked public schools in 82082, WY are Pine Bluffs Elementary School and Pine Bluffs Jr & Sr High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 82082 have an average math proficiency score of 52% (versus the Wyoming public school average of 49%), and reading proficiency score of 49% (versus the 53% statewide average). Schools in 82082, WY have an average ranking of 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Wyoming public schools.
Minority enrollment is 20%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Wyoming public school average of 25% (majority Hispanic).
